Calcium hypophosphite is used as flame retardant, animal feed food additive, with high purity and obvious effect. It can be synthesized by sodium hypophosphite and calcium chloride, and the decomposition temperature of calcium hypophosphite reaches 300 degrees, which has better flame retardant effect in some plastics, such as PA6. If calcium hypophosphite is not stored properly, it may absorb moisture and caking, and the caking phenomenon can be prevented by adding chemical additives.

Basic information

English name: Calcium hypophosphite

Chemical formula: Ca(H2PO2)2

CAS NO.: 7789-79-9

EINECS: 232-190-8

Molecular weight: 170.06

Properties: white crystalline powder, soluble in water, insoluble in alcohol. The solubility of calcium hypophosphite in water at room temperature is 16.7g/100g water. Its aqueous solution shows weak acidity.

Use of Calcium Hypophosphite

Calcium hypophosphite can be used as flame retardant, chemical plating, food additives and animal nutrients, used in the manufacture of pharmaceuticals, and can be used as antioxidants, analytical reagents.

 

Packing and transportation

Net weight 25kg kraft paper bag lined with polyethylene bag. The product should be sealed and stored in a dry, light-proof and cool place.

The price of calcium hypophosphite is very closely related to the price of yellow phosphorus and the price of sodium hypophosphite, with regular fluctuations from time to time. The use of calcium hypophosphite has only begun to be recognized in recent years, and more roles are still being researched and developed.
